The Arthritis Score in 41257, Stambaugh, Kentucky is 52 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

92.03 percent of the population in 41257 drive to work alone. 4.71 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 55.43 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 15.94 percent of the residents in 41257 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.45 members with about 2.52 cars available per household.

An estimate of 94.76 percent of the residents in 41257 has some form of health insurance. 65.10 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 36.41 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 41257 would have to travel an average of 4.92 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Paintsville Arh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 41257, Stambaugh, Kentucky.

As of , an estimate of 725 residents live in 41257 with a median age of 42.1 years. 13.38 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 10.07 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 30.58 percent of the residents in 41257 is currently married, and 25.80 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 41257 is $4,474.17.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 41257 is approximately $608. The median household spends about 13.59 percent of their income on housing.
